Toll Brothers has unveiled 280 North at Doylestown, a boutique enclave of 18 four-story luxury townhomes situated at 1 Dutch Lane in Bucks County, Pennsylvania. The development is set to open for sale in fall 2026.
Each townhome includes an elevator, flex space, open-concept kitchen, rooftop terrace with expansive views and a two-car garage. Pricing is projected to begin in the upper $900,000s.
The community is walkable to downtown Doylestown’s shopping, dining and cultural attractions and sits adjacent to Broad Commons Park and a public dog park. It also offers convenient access to U.S. Route 202, PA Route 611 and the Pennsylvania Turnpike.
